A Conversation with Reindeer Guide Olli Heikkilä
To truly understand what reindeer herding means in Lapland today, we sat down with our reindeer guide, Olli Heikkilä, whose life has always been closely connected to the Arctic wilderness. As we talked beside the reindeer fence, surrounded by the silence of the forest and the gentle sound of reindeer moving through the snow, Olli shared what this traditional way of life means to him personally.
For Olli, reindeer herding is much more than a profession — it is a way of living in harmony with nature.
“It is my job, but I enjoy it because I can spend my days with animals and in nature doing many kinds of things. Every day is different,” Olli explains. “I get to experience the beauty of Lapland while working, and animals have always been close to my heart. Being with reindeer every day feels very natural to me.”
Although modern Lapland has changed over the years, reindeer continue to hold an important place in local culture and identity.
“Reindeer are still part of traditional Lappish culture and lifestyle,” Olli says. “Nowadays they are also an important part of tourism. Reindeer sleigh rides and farm visits are very popular and help people from around the world experience this way of life.”
During our conversation, Olli also spoke about some common misconceptions people have about reindeer.
“Many people think reindeer simply wander around freely and nobody takes care of them,” he laughs. “But reindeer herding involves constant work throughout the year. People are also often surprised by how intelligent reindeer are. And many visitors don’t know that reindeer lose their antlers every winter and grow new ones again during summer.”
Living so closely with nature has shaped Olli’s entire lifestyle. His connection to the land extends far beyond work.
“I basically live in nature,” he tells us. “My home is near the forest and river. I hunt, fish, and spend most of my free time outdoors. Nature is both my workplace and the place where I rest.”
Lapland’s Arctic conditions can be harsh, but reindeer are perfectly adapted to survive here. According to Olli, their physical features are remarkable examples of nature’s design.
“They have long, thin legs that are excellent for walking in snow,” he explains. “Their hooves work well in many different terrains, especially deep snow. Reindeer hair is hollow, which protects them from rain, snow, and ice. They also eat lichen and many other plants, so they can adapt to changing weather conditions.”
As the conversation came to an end, Olli reflected on what makes Lapland so special for this unique lifestyle.
“The nature here is unique,” he says while looking across the snowy forest. “Large forest areas and peaceful surroundings make Lapland the ideal place for reindeer herding and living close to nature.”
